Draw Basic Vector Shapes. Select the tool for the shape you want to draw, then add your Fill and Stroke colors. Now click and drag in your canvas. The shape is drawn from the corner in whichever direction you're dragging. To create a symmetrical shape, such as a circle or square, hold down the Shift key.

Convert your JPG image to an SVG for free. Scalable Vector Graphics (SVG) is a web-friendly vector file format. JPGs are raster files and are made up of pixels. Vector graphics, like SVGs, always maintain their resolution — no matter how large or small you make them.
